    Why a 500 GPM Pump Is Ideal for Mid-Scale Industrial Fluid Handling

    adminBy adminFebruary 27, 2026No Comments4 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r WhatsApp VKontakte Email
    Why a 500 GPM Pump Is Ideal for Mid-Scale Industrial Fluid Handling
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    In industrial fluid systems, selecting the correct flow capacity is critical. Oversized pumps can waste energy and increase operational costs, while undersized pumps can create bottlenecks and system strain. For many mid-scale operations, a 500 gpm pump offers the right balance between performance, efficiency, and cost-effectiveness.

    Let’s explore why this capacity range is often ideal for medium-duty industrial applications.


    The Challenge: Matching Flow Capacity to System Demand

    Mid-scale industrial facilities often face:

    • Moderate but continuous fluid transfer needs
    • Limited infrastructure compared to large-scale plants
    • Budget-conscious capital investments
    • Energy efficiency targets

    Choosing a pump that exceeds system requirements can increase:

    • Power consumption
    • Mechanical stress
    • Maintenance frequency

    Selecting one that falls short can reduce throughput and strain equipment.

    A 500 GPM pump often strikes the right balance.


    What Does 500 GPM Mean?

    GPM (gallons per minute) measures how much fluid a pump can transfer in one minute.

    A 500 GPM pump is designed to:

    • Move 500 gallons per minute under specified head conditions
    • Handle continuous industrial-duty cycles
    • Provide stable flow for medium-volume systems

    This capacity suits facilities that require steady flow without the scale of large industrial complexes.


    Industries That Benefit from 500 GPM Pumps

    1. Chemical Processing (Mid-Sized Plants)

    Mid-scale chemical facilities use 500 GPM pumps for:

    • Process fluid circulation
    • Transfer between tanks
    • Reactor feed systems
    • Effluent movement

    The capacity supports stable operations without excessive energy demand.


    2. Industrial Wastewater Systems

    Manufacturing plants often require:

    • Effluent transfer
    • Filtration support
    • Sludge handling

    A 500 GPM pump provides sufficient throughput while maintaining manageable infrastructure requirements.


    3. Cooling Water Circulation

    Facilities with moderate cooling loads—such as:

    • Food processing units
    • Pharmaceutical plants
    • Textile manufacturing

    benefit from consistent flow without the need for large-scale pumping systems.


    4. Irrigation and Water Distribution

    Agricultural and industrial irrigation systems frequently operate in mid-volume ranges where:

    • Uniform distribution
    • Controlled pressure
    • Energy efficiency

    are essential.


    5. Fire Protection Systems

    Some industrial fire suppression systems require high reliability but not ultra-large capacity. A 500 GPM pump can provide adequate flow for many mid-sized facilities.


    Key Advantages of a 500 GPM Pump

    1. Balanced Energy Consumption

    Compared to higher-capacity pumps, a 500 GPM unit:

    • Consumes less power
    • Operates closer to optimal efficiency
    • Reduces long-term operating costs

    Properly sized pumps avoid unnecessary energy waste.


    2. Lower Infrastructure Requirements

    Mid-scale pumps often require:

    • Smaller motor ratings
    • Reduced piping diameter
    • Simpler installation setups

    This lowers capital investment and simplifies system design.


    3. Reduced Mechanical Stress

    Oversized pumps operating below capacity can experience inefficiencies and wear.

    A properly sized 500 GPM pump:

    • Operates near best efficiency point (BEP)
    • Reduces vibration
    • Extends equipment lifespan

    Correct sizing protects system components.


    4. Flexibility Across Applications

    Mid-capacity pumps are versatile. They can be adapted for:

    • Corrosive fluids (with proper materials)
    • Moderate head conditions
    • Continuous or intermittent operation

    Material compatibility ensures long-term reliability.


    Design Considerations When Selecting a 500 GPM Pump

    When evaluating specifications, consider:

    • Total Dynamic Head (TDH)
    • Fluid temperature
    • Chemical compatibility
    • Abrasive content
    • Duty cycle (continuous vs intermittent)
    • Motor efficiency

    Matching pump curves with system requirements ensures optimal performance.


    Avoiding Common Selection Errors

    • Choosing based on flow alone without considering head
    • Ignoring fluid properties
    • Overlooking energy efficiency curves
    • Failing to plan for future expansion

    Accurate system analysis prevents costly oversights.


    Final Thoughts

    Not every industrial application requires ultra-high flow capacity. For many mid-scale operations, the ideal solution lies in balanced performance.

    A well-engineered 500 gpm pump delivers efficient, reliable fluid handling without the complexity or cost of oversized systems. By aligning pump capacity with operational demand, industrial facilities can optimize energy use, reduce maintenance, and maintain consistent process performance.

    In fluid handling systems, right-sizing is not just a technical decision—it is a strategic one.
